Manchego Lamb

The origin of Manchego sheep must be sought among the primitive Mediterranean sheep that formed part of the first branch of the species that adapted to dry countries, strongly dependent on seasonal climate. After their western expansion, the race acquired its own features, showing notable differences from their relatives with trunks and from there went on to their definitive settling, when the race diversified to form Spanish races (Aragonese, Castilian, Segureña and Manchego), as well as French and Portuguese.

Sheep from La Mancha are now dual-purpose sheep, milk-meat. The majority of dairy production is for the preparation of cheeses with the Manchego Cheese Guarantee of Origin.

Regarding the production of meat, like other races of sheep, its historical journey has progressed under the influence of different successive types of business. The Manchego race really took off as a producer of meat when industrial feedlots came into operation. Its considerable volume of work and experience, emphasises that Manchego lamb is the best.

That is why, in 1993 the Protected Denomination "Manchego Lamb" was created, its regulations being approved in 1995 and the first certified products entering the market in December 1998.
